From: danielk1977 Date: Sun, 24 Jun 2007 06:32:17 +0000 (+0000) Subject: When expanding '*' in the result set of a SELECT, quote the expanded identifiers... X-Git-Tag: version-3.4.1~59 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=f3b863ed07ef55044d7052044e1928dea114412e;p=thirdparty%2Fsqlite.git When expanding '*' in the result set of a SELECT, quote the expanded identifiers. Fix for #2450.
